Kalka named Fox World Travel Sr. Director, Global Sales
Fox World Travel is pleased to announce George Kalka has joined Fox’s business travel sales team.
Kalka has been named the Senior Director of Global Sales. In his role, he will join the Fox World Travel sales team and partner with stakeholders across the organization to focus on large market opportunities nationally, particularly in the eastern United States and Ohio.
A highly-respected leader, Kalka has worked in the hospitality and travel industry for more than 15 years serving in regional, national and executive sales roles. In a prior position as Fox’s Senior Director of Account Management, he directed the implementation of global travel programs, integrated Fox’s meeting management and client solutions teams, and delivered commercial technology solutions to the company’s business travel customers.
“I’m thrilled to bring Fox’s proven multinational travel management solutions to organizations in the eastern U.S., providing cost reductions and industry-leading technology while enriching the service provided to their travelers,” Kalka stated. “I’m proud to work with an experienced team at Fox that’s passionate about helping customers achieve expert travel management.”
